Californium (atomic number = 98) is a member of

A

s - block

B

p - block

C

d - block

D

f - block

Text Solution

AI Generated Solution

The correct Answer is:
To determine which block Californium (atomic number 98) belongs to, we need to analyze its electronic configuration step by step. ### Step 1: Determine the Electronic Configuration To find the electronic configuration of Californium, we start from the lowest energy level and fill the orbitals according to the Aufbau principle. The order of filling is as follows: - 1s² - 2s² - 2p⁶ - 3s² - 3p⁶ - 4s² - 3d¹⁰ - 4p⁶ - 5s² - 4d¹⁰ - 5p⁶ - 6s² - 4f¹⁴ - 5d¹⁰ - 6p⁶ - 7s² - 5f¹⁰ - 6d¹⁰ - 7p⁶ ### Step 2: Identify the Last Filled Orbital For Californium (atomic number 98), we continue filling the orbitals until we reach the 98th electron. The electronic configuration can be summarized as: \[ \text{[Rn]} \, 7s^2 \, 5f^{10} \, 6d^{0} \] Here, the last filled orbital is 5f, which indicates that the outermost electrons are being filled in the f-block. ### Step 3: Determine the Block Since the last filled orbital for Californium is 5f, we conclude that Californium belongs to the f-block of the periodic table. ### Conclusion Therefore, Californium (atomic number 98) is a member of the f-block. ---
